What are the responsibilities and job description for the Administrative Support Specialist - Bilingual position at Masis Staffing?
Job Description
Purpose
Support the design and execution and constant improvement of the administrative systems for the day-to-day operations of the Risk Management Department of Masis Staffing Solutions, LLC. Contributes to the efficient Masis operations by performing their duties accurately and in a timely manner.
Role and Responsibilities
- Assists with Managing new candidate generation and job order generation through Masis Staffing Solution CRM Software.
- Keep updated records of termination of employment on CRM software and cooperate with unemployment investigations.
- Keeps strict attention to detail to all candidate related processes including screening, interviewing, training, onboarding, and termination.
- Communicate efficiently with Branch Manager and Business Development Manager on the status of job orders and all other client or candidate relevant matters.
- Maintain strict level of confidentiality and adherence to company policy while interacting with candidates and clients.
- Perform other duties as requested.
QUALIFICATIONS AND EDUCATION REQUIREMENTS
- College preferred.
- Must have 1-3 years successful recruiting or business development experience.
- Strong interviewing skills and understanding of staffing industry. Ability to speak more than one language highly desirable.
- Proficiency in multiple computer software applications is necessary.
